Transaction 393dc831218808a69db59a9051746174e93f395cd86790551a7839ccc5074417
1 Input
1 Output
-
393dc831218808a69db59a9051746174e93f395cd86790551a7839ccc5074417:0
- value
- 8841168
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fa9ce0ce6c54db70c94c3a9af246fd371677a3d
- address
- bc1q075uur8xc4xmwry5cw567fr06dckw73akppe0n